Mesa 7i92+7i76+7i85S

More
17 Sep 2022 14:59 #252173 by PCW
Replied by PCW on topic Mesa 7i92+7i76+7i85S
OK so the 7I76 is not being detected (no sserial communications)

Possible reasons for no communication:
1. Cable power jumpers on 7I92  and 7I76 miss-matched
2. Cable errors
3. 7I76 not connected to  P2
4. 7I76 jumpered for setup, not operation
5. Hardware issues (damaged 7I92 or 7I76)
The following user(s) said Thank You: tommylight

Please Log in or Create an account to join the conversation.

More
18 Sep 2022 16:22 #252273 by Artur_1617
Replied by Artur_1617 on topic Mesa 7i92+7i76+7i85S
This was the problem  4. 7I76 jumpered for setup, not operation now linuxcnc starting.
Another problem I dont see any voltage on TB4 pins 1, 2, 3 when I start spindle and setup for example 3000rpm  
I see only 0,4Volt on pins 5 and 6 

Please Log in or Create an account to join the conversation.

More
18 Sep 2022 16:45 #252274 by PCW
Replied by PCW on topic Mesa 7i92+7i76+7i85S
Note that TB4 pins 1,2,3 do not output any voltage by themselves,
they are intended to replace a potentiometer so typically
TB4.3 goes to the VFDs +10V, TB4.1 goes to VFD analog GND
and TB4.2 goes to the VFD analog input (the potentiometer wiper connection)

Likewise, TB4s ENA and DIR outputs do not output voltages,
they are simply switches.

Please Log in or Create an account to join the conversation.

More
04 Oct 2022 10:08 - 04 Oct 2022 10:11 #253429 by Artur_1617
Replied by Artur_1617 on topic Mesa 7i92+7i76+7i85S
I connect all to the lathe.
Get out setp pid.N.maxerror .0005 and   net N-vel-cmd => pid.N.command-deriv
The linear scales read ok.
I cant properly ajust step motors.
If I setup P to 1000 get big oscilations and must lower to 10.
Ballscrew is 2505
Linear scales 0,001

 

File Attachment:

File Name: tokarka_20...0-04.ini
File Size:3 KB

File Attachment:

File Name: tokarka_20...0-04.hal
File Size:10 KB
Attachments:
Last edit: 04 Oct 2022 10:11 by Artur_1617.

Please Log in or Create an account to join the conversation.

More
04 Oct 2022 14:12 #253448 by PCW
Replied by PCW on topic Mesa 7i92+7i76+7i85S
P will be much smaller for encoder feedback because the delays from step
command to actual motion limit the maximum stable gain. I would also expect
FF1 t be exactly 1.000 since this should get the step generator moving properly
even without feedback.

Also did you get this all working with stepgen feedback before changing to encoder feedback? Is the encoders scale properly?

Please Log in or Create an account to join the conversation.

More
04 Oct 2022 14:38 #253453 by Artur_1617
Replied by Artur_1617 on topic Mesa 7i92+7i76+7i85S
Encoder scale is ok 1000 for 0,001 linear scale
I dont try working with stepgen feedback before changing to encoder feedback.
Which line delete for see stepgen feedback?
On steppers I can chose microstep settings up to 51200 and for now I setup 1000 is correct?

Please Log in or Create an account to join the conversation.

More
04 Oct 2022 14:53 #253454 by PCW
Replied by PCW on topic Mesa 7i92+7i76+7i85S
to change to stepgen feedback, you would change

net x-pos-fb <= hm2_7i92.0.encoder.02.position
to
net x-pos-fb <= hm2_7i92.0.stepgen.00.position-fb

(for x)

Note that the encoder and stepgen scaling and direction must be equal
(that is whatever microstep ratio you use the step scale must be set correctly)

Please Log in or Create an account to join the conversation.

More
04 Oct 2022 17:15 #253459 by Artur_1617
Replied by Artur_1617 on topic Mesa 7i92+7i76+7i85S
I set to net x-pos-fb <= hm2_7i92.0.stepgen.00.position-fb
And play with settings.
Now settings is:
STEPGEN_MAXVEL = 30
STEPGEN_MAXACCEL = 1000
P = 30
I = 0
D = 0
FF0 = 0.004
FF1 = 1
FF2 = 0.002
BIAS
After that axis moving smmotly and F.error is about 0,004
When I set back to net x-pos-fb <= hm2_7i92.0.encoder.02.position  
Now problem is when I move for example 1mm axis going 1.01mm and back -0.01mm and finally is 1mm
Or moving -0.5 axis going -0.51 and back 0.01
Must set STEP_SCALE = 1020  becouse axis dont make 1mm only 0.98mm (this was set with only stepgen feedback and watching dial indicator)

 

Please Log in or Create an account to join the conversation.

More
05 Oct 2022 17:56 #253549 by Artur_1617
Replied by Artur_1617 on topic Mesa 7i92+7i76+7i85S
I have problem with X axis.
I change to stepgen feedback.
For correct moving with dial indicator must setup steper scale to 850     and moving 0.1mm the move is 0.1mm
Stepper drive is set to 4000 and ballscrew is 1204 
When I back to encoder feedback the axis moving .02 more than expected,   moving 0,1mm axis move 0.12mm

Please Log in or Create an account to join the conversation.

More
06 Oct 2022 14:21 #253611 by Artur_1617
Replied by Artur_1617 on topic Mesa 7i92+7i76+7i85S
Play all day with pid and not lucky.
Setting steper scales I use test bar from micrometer 200mm long, now the scale is 100% correct.
Disconecting steppers and moving axis with hand, dro show ok encoder scale is ok.
Read several topics but don find answer for my problem.
If axis is setting to stepgen feedback and move them 1mm axis stop on 1mm if I setting to encoder feedback and move 1mm axis going 1.02mm and back 0.02mm
Any help?

Please Log in or Create an account to join the conversation.

Moderators: PCWjmelson
Time to create page: 0.236 seconds
Powered by Kunena Forum